dc.description.abstract The volatile components of the leaf oil of Evodia calophylla Guill. from the Nghean province, Vietnam were analyzed by GC and GC/MS. Thirty-three compounds, comprising 95.2% of the GC profile of the oil were identified. The three major constituents were α-pinene (9.2%), (Z)-β-ocimene (17.5%) and (E)-β-ocimene (46.6%). © 2009 Allured Business Media. vi
